Q. What are the secondary and the primary constrictions of a chromosome? And what is the other name given to the secondary constriction?
Primary constriction is the narrower region of a condensed chromosome where the centromere, the structure that are unites identical chromatids, is located. Secondary constriction is a region alike to the primary constriction, narrower than the normal thickness of the chromosome too, and in general it is related to genes that coordinate the formation of the nucleolus and control the ribosomic the RNA (rRNA) synthesis. For this reason the secondary contrictions that can be one or more in chromosome is called nucleolus organizer region (NOR).
